How to Improve Your Online Privacy Today
Want to boost your digital privacy today ? It’s simpler than you imagine. Start by examining your browser history and clearing your browsing data. Next, enable two-factor verification on your important accounts. Consider using a encrypted tool like DuckDuckGo and installing a reputable VPN to hide your IP address . Finally, be careful more info of the details you share on social media – your online footprint is important!
